从图像中删除白色背景

从图像中删除白色背景

问题描述:

我想为我的图像获得透明背景或无背景。我尝试了'-background none'选项和'透明'选项,但背景图像保持白色。我怎样才能做到这一点?从图像中删除白色背景

请建议。

+0

的瘸子例子并您的图像有任何机会,一个白色的背景? – 2011-03-08 08:28:32

+0

是的,它显示了白色背景,即使我没有创建。 – 2011-03-08 12:19:21

+0

可能需要更多信息。你问如何创建一个透明的GIF或PNG?或者如何使图像在某些开发或HTML环境中具有透明度?要么? – gwideman 2011-03-08 08:25:21

什么是你的图像格式?请尝试使用PNG格式

+0

我使用的是png格式。 – 2011-03-08 12:15:55

+0

我使用PNG格式。甚至尝试在imagemagick中创建一些基本形状,但总是会创建一个白色的环形矩形,但我将背景设置为none。 – 2011-03-08 12:31:49

如果您正在使用Imagemagik则命令为:

convert input.gif -transparent white output.gif 

但是它只会采用了纯白色的背景,而不是白色阴影工作。 用IrfanView或The Gimp或Photoshop(下面会详细介绍)还有其他更简单的方法。 本文提到您可能会使用Windows自带的convert.exe而不是ImageMagicks Convert.exe,在这种情况下,您应该使用Convert.exe的完整路径。 http://www.imagemagick.org/discourse-server/viewtopic.php?f=1&t=10665

如果您试图从CSS实现此目的,那么您误解了CSS属性。 CSS属性'背景'是指html元素的背景颜色。即无论如何。 更多这里http://www.w3schools.com/css/css_background.asp

如果您指的是图像不透明属性,它指的是图像应该如何“透视”。更这里: http://www.w3schools.com/Css/css_image_transparency.asp

获得的图像中的透明背景的唯一方法是透明使用图像的背景任PNG(优选的)或GIF格式,使。为此,您可以使用IrfanView并将图片保存为PNG,选择“保存透明度”属性并从图像中选择要透明的颜色,或者您可以使用Photoshop或Gimp也可以做同样的事情。举例IrfanView这里http://llizard.etherwork.net/cwc/transp_irfanview.html

这里http://aplawrence.com/Linux/crousegif.html